Blaise defended his PhD on a socio-ecological approach to Brown bear management in the Pyrenees

Blaise defended his PhD I co-supervised with Pierre-Yves Quenette from ONCFS (manuscript here). Blaise studied the attitudes of the public toward brown bear presence and provided sound estimates of abundance and distribution for the species in the Pyrenees.

Laura Cowen's sabbatical

Laura Cowen from the Department of Math and Stat at University of Victoria (Canada) will be on a sabbatical with us for 3 months. We will be working on the applications of hidden Markov models to capture-recapture data.
